Low-Carb Cauliflower Gratin with Sharp Cheddar and Parmesan

Ingredients
1 medium head cauliflower, cut into bite-sized pieces
1 cup finely grated sharp cheddar cheese
4 T mayo
4 T sour cream
1 T fresh squeezed lemon juice
1/2 tsp. Dijon mustard
fresh ground black pepper to taste
3 T finely grated Parmesan cheese
Directions
Preheat oven to 375F/190C. Cut cauliflower into bite sized pieces. Put cauliflower in a small pot, add water to cover by a few inches, then bring to boil and cook 10 minutes, or until cauliflower is just starting to get tender. Drain cauliflower into a colander placed in the sink and let it drain very well. While cauliflower cooks, stir together mayo, sour cream, lemon juice, Dijon mustard, and black pepper. Stir in finely grated sharp cheddar. Spray a large glass or crockery baking dish with olive oil or non-stick spray, then pour the well-drained cauliflower into the dish and spread out evenly. Use a rubber scraper to spread gratin mixture over the top of the cauliflower.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and bake uncovered for 25-30 minutes, or until cauliflower is bubbling and lightly browned. Serve hot.
